public static final class MultiSpeakerVoiceConfig.Builder extends GeneratedMessageV3.Builder<MultiSpeakerVoiceConfig.Builder> implements MultiSpeakerVoiceConfigOrBuilder
   
   Configuration for a multi-speaker text-to-speech setup. Enables the use of up
 to two distinct voices in a single synthesis request.
 Protobuf type google.cloud.texttospeech.v1.MultiSpeakerVoiceConfig
    Inherited Members
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
    
      com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
    
    
    
    
    
    
    
      com.google.protobuf.GeneratedMessageV3.Builder.internalGetMapFieldReflection(int)
    
    
    
      com.google.protobuf.GeneratedMessageV3.Builder.internalGetMutableMapFieldReflection(int)
    
    
    
    
    
    
      com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
    
    
      com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
    
    
    
    
    
      com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
    
    
    
    
      com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
    
    
    
    
    
    
    
    
    
    
    
    
   
  Static Methods
  
  
  getDescriptor()
  
    public static final Descriptors.Descriptor getDescriptor()
   
  
  Methods
  
  
  addAllSpeakerVoiceConfigs(Iterable<? extends MultispeakerPrebuiltVoice> values)
  
    public MultiSpeakerVoiceConfig.Builder addAllSpeakerVoiceConfigs(Iterable<? extends MultispeakerPrebuiltVoice> values)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Parameter | 
      
        | Name | Description | 
      
        | values | Iterable<? extends com.google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ice>
 | 
    
  
  
  
  addRepeatedField(Descriptors.FieldDescriptor field, Object value)
  
    public MultiSpeakerVoiceConfig.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
   
  
  
  Overrides
  
  
  addSpeakerVoiceConfigs(MultispeakerPrebuiltVoice value)
  
    public MultiSpeakerVoiceConfig.Builder addSpeakerVoiceConfigs(MultispeakerPrebuiltVoice value)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
addSpeakerVoiceConfigs(MultispeakerPrebuiltVoice.Builder builderForValue)
  
    public MultiSpeakerVoiceConfig.Builder addSpeakerVoiceConfigs(MultispeakerPrebuiltVoice.Builder builderForValue)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
addS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ice value)
  
    public MultiSpeakerVoiceConfig.Builder addS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ice value)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
addS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ice.Builder builderForValue)
  
    public MultiSpeakerVoiceConfig.Builder addS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ice.Builder builderForValue)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
addSpeakerVoiceConfigsBuilder()
  
    public MultispeakerPrebuiltVoice.Builder addSpeakerVoiceConfigsBuilder()
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
addSpeakerVoiceConfigsBuilder(int index)
  
    public MultispeakerPrebuiltVoice.Builder addSpeakerVoiceConfigsBuilder(int index)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Parameter | 
      
        | Name | Description | 
      
        | index | int
 | 
    
  
  
  
  build()
  
    public MultiSpeakerVoiceConfig build()
   
  
  
  buildPartial()
  
    public MultiSpeakerVoiceConfig buildPartial()
   
  
  
  clear()
  
    public MultiSpeakerVoiceConfig.Builder clear()
   
  
  Overrides
  
  
  clearField(Descriptors.FieldDescriptor field)
  
    public MultiSpeakerVoiceConfig.Builder clearField(Descriptors.FieldDescriptor field)
   
  
  
  Overrides
  
  
  clearOneof(Descriptors.OneofDescriptor oneof)
  
    public MultiSpeakerVoiceConfig.Builder clearOneof(Descriptors.OneofDescriptor oneof)
   
  
  
  Overrides
  
  
  clearSpeakerVoiceConfigs()
  
    public MultiSpeakerVoiceConfig.Builder clearSpeakerVoiceConfigs()
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
clone()
  
    public MultiSpeakerVoiceConfig.Builder clone()
   
  
  Overrides
  
  
  getDefaultInstanceForType()
  
    public MultiSpeakerVoiceConfig getDefaultInstanceForType()
   
  
  
  getDescriptorForType()
  
    public Descriptors.Descriptor getDescriptorForType()
   
  
  Overrides
  
  
  getSpeakerVoiceConfigs(int index)
  
    public MultispeakerPrebuiltVoice getSpeakerVoiceConfigs(int index)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Parameter | 
      
        | Name | Description | 
      
        | index | int
 | 
    
  
  
  
  getSpeakerVoiceConfigsBuilder(int index)
  
    public MultispeakerPrebuiltVoice.Builder getSpeakerVoiceConfigsBuilder(int index)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Parameter | 
      
        | Name | Description | 
      
        | index | int
 | 
    
  
  
  
  getSpeakerVoiceConfigsBuilderList()
  
    public List<MultispeakerPrebuiltVoice.Builder> getSpeakerVoiceConfigsBuilderList()
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
getSpeakerVoiceConfigsCount()
  
    public int getSpeakerVoiceConfigsCount()
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Returns | 
      
        | Type | Description | 
      
        | int |  | 
    
  
  
  getSpeakerVoiceConfigsList()
  
    public List<MultispeakerPrebuiltVoice> getSpeakerVoiceConfigsList()
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
getSpeakerVoiceConfigsOrBuilder(int index)
  
    public MultispeakerPrebuiltVoiceOrBuilder getSpeakerVoiceConfigsOrBuilder(int index)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Parameter | 
      
        | Name | Description | 
      
        | index | int
 | 
    
  
  
  
  getSpeakerVoiceConfigsOrBuilderList()
  
    public List<? extends MultispeakerPrebuiltVoiceOrBuilder> getSpeakerVoiceConfigsOrBuilderList()
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Returns | 
      
        | Type | Description | 
      
        | List<? extends com.google.cloud.texttospeech.v1.MultispeakerPrebuiltVoiceOrBuilder> |  | 
    
  
  
  internalGetFieldAccessorTable()
  
    prot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
   
  
  Overrides
  
  
  isInitialized()
  
    public final boolean isInitialized()
   
  
  Overrides
  
  
  mergeFrom(MultiSpeakerVoiceConfig other)
  
    public MultiSpeakerVoiceConfig.Builder mergeFrom(MultiSpeakerVoiceConfig other)
   
  
  
  
  m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
  
    public MultiSpeakerVoiceConfig.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
   
  
  
  Overrides
  
  
  
  mergeFrom(Message other)
  
    public MultiSpeakerVoiceConfig.Builder mergeFrom(Message other)
   
  
    
      
        | Parameter | 
      
        | Name | Description | 
      
        | other | Message
 | 
    
  
  
  Overrides
  
  
  mergeUnknownFields(UnknownFieldSet unknownFields)
  
    public final MultiSpeakerVoiceConfig.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
   
  
  
  Overrides
  
  
  removeSpeakerVoiceConfigs(int index)
  
    public MultiSpeakerVoiceConfig.Builder removeSpeakerVoiceConfigs(int index)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
    
      
        | Parameter | 
      
        | Name | Description | 
      
        | index | int
 | 
    
  
  
  
  setField(Descriptors.FieldDescriptor field, Object value)
  
    public MultiSpeakerVoiceConfig.Builder setField(Descriptors.FieldDescriptor field, Object value)
   
  
  
  Overrides
  
  
  set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
  
    public MultiSpeakerVoiceConfig.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
   
  
  
  Overrides
  
  
  setS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ice value)
  
    public MultiSpeakerVoiceConfig.Builder setS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ice value)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
setS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ice.Builder builderForValue)
  
    public MultiSpeakerVoiceConfig.Builder setSpeakerVoiceConfigs(int index, MultispeakerPrebuiltVoice.Builder builderForValue)
   
   Required. A list of configurations for the voices of the speakers. Exactly
 two speaker voice configurations must be provided.
 
 repeated .google.cloud.texttospeech.v1.MultispeakerPrebuiltVoice speaker_voice_configs = 2 [(.google.api.field_behavior) = REQUIRED];
 
setUnknownFields(UnknownFieldSet unknownFields)
  
    public final MultiSpeakerVoiceConfig.Builder setUnknownFields(UnknownFieldSet unknownFields)
   
  
  
  Overrides